Varsity Boys Volleyball extends its winning streak to 7 games

TODD HODKEY

Medina Gazette | 4/11/2026

The varsity boys volleyball team extended its winning streak to 7 games with a pair of wins on Friday night against Mayfield and Amherst Steele. The Bees swept both the Wildcats (25-8, 25-15, 25-13) and the Comets (25-19, 25-14, 25-13).
Brayden Howells led the team in the opener with 21 assists and 11 digs. Oliver Singer added 10 kills, while Trent Balicki posted 19 digs.
In the nightcap, Howells had 28 assists and Singer had 14 kills. Ashton Knowles added 9 kills and Balicki had 8 digs.

Medina improves to 10-1 overall on the season. The boys will be back in league action on Tuesday when they host Cleveland Heights.
